Solingen, surnommée la "Cité des Lames", est célèbre pour sa coutellerie de haute qualité. Les plats typiques comprennent le "Rheinischer Sauerbraten" (rôti de boeuf mariné) et le "Pillekuchen" (gâteau de pommes de terre).
